Job Summary:
The Masters of Science in Occupational Therapy Program is seeking candidates for multiple adjunct teaching positions as well as adjunct faculty to develop curriculum and secure fieldwork contracts.Job Status:
Part time***
Job Description:
Subject Matter Experts and teaching faculty needed in the following areas:
Anatomy
Neuroscience
Orthopedic upper extremity occupational therapy assessment and intervention
Modalities
Assistive technology including 3-D printing
Mental health conditions assessment and interventions
Pediatric health conditions assessment and interventions
Adolescent and young adults conditions assessment and interventions
Level I fieldwork educators at community sites
Supervision of students during didactic class experience at community clinics
Mentoring and supervision of students in small group learning communities
Assisting full-time faculty in lab courses in multiple courses
Responsibilities for curriculum development begin immediately and responsibilities for teaching begin August 2025.
Qualified applicants should have a masters of science degree in occupational therapy or an entry-level post-professional occupational therapy doctorate degree or another equivalent doctorate degree. The successful candidate will be expected to demonstrate effective teaching in either the classroom clinical or academic setting. The candidate must embrace the mission of Point Loma Nazarene University.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Adjunct faculty members must have knowledge of instructional strategies and techniques appropriate to effective undergraduate or graduate teaching. Adjuncts are also expected to have knowledge of ways to instruct manage motivate and evaluate students and do the following:
Teach graduate courses
Invest in students professional development
Participate in Point Loma Nazarene University activities as appropriate
Mentor students in research or professional experiences as appropriate
QUALIFICATIONS
Masters preferred Bachelors accepted
Potential for outstanding teaching as demonstrated by prior classroom or clinical teaching
Five or more years of clinical experience as an occupational therapist with a demonstrated area of clinical expertise
Past experience supervising Level I and/or Level II fieldwork students
Past experience creating new curriculum at the graduate level in occupational therapy (for persons developing curriculum only)
Philosophical: Thorough commitment to the concept of Christian liberal arts education and a desire to work in a Christian university. Supportive of the religious and educational goals of the university and its sponsoring denomination.
Personal: Evidence of Christian commitment and active church addition faculty agree to live in agreement with PLNUs Community Life Covenant.
